详情介绍

一、了解Chrome浏览器特性
- 核心渲染引擎:Chrome使用V8 JavaScript引擎,这是其性能优势的核心所在。了解这一点对于编写高效、可扩展的代码至关重要。
- Blink渲染器:Chrome还使用Blink渲染器来处理CSS和JavaScript,这是现代浏览器的标准做法。了解这一部分可以帮助您更好地与主流浏览器保持一致。
- WebExtensions API:Chrome提供了丰富的API,允许开发者创建扩展程序,以增强浏览器的功能。掌握这些API将使您能够为Chrome用户提供独特的体验。
二、遵循最佳实践
- 使用标准HTML和CSS:确保您的网页使用标准的HTML和CSS,以便所有浏览器都能正确渲染。这包括避免使用旧版浏览器不支持的特性。
- 考虑不同分辨率:考虑到不同设备的屏幕尺寸和分辨率,确保您的网页在不同设备上都有良好的显示效果。
- 测试跨浏览器兼容性:使用在线工具如BrowserStack或Selenium进行跨浏览器测试,以确保您的网页在所有主流浏览器上都能正常工作。
三、使用工具和资源
- 浏览器开发者工具:利用Chrome浏览器内置的开发者工具,如Console、Network等,来调试和监控网页的性能和兼容性问题。
- 第三方工具:使用如Lighthouse、PageSpeed Insights等第三方工具,可以提供更详细的性能分析和改进建议。
- 官方文档和教程:参考Chrome的官方文档和教程,了解最新的兼容性要求和技术趋势。
四、持续更新和维护
- 关注新版本:定期检查Chrome浏览器的更新,并及时应用这些更新,以确保您的网页能够充分利用新功能。
- 修复已知问题:在发现任何兼容性问题时,及时修复它们,以避免影响用户体验。
- 保持代码库更新:随着技术的发展,新的编程语言和框架不断涌现。保持您的代码库更新,以适应这些变化。
五、社区支持和反馈
- 加入开发者社区:参与Chrome开发者论坛和其他社区,与其他开发者交流经验和技巧。
- 寻求反馈:向用户收集关于您的网页兼容性的反馈,这有助于您了解哪些地方需要改进。
- 参与开源项目:如果您有能力,可以考虑参与开源项目,贡献您的代码,同时也能获得宝贵的经验。
六、案例分析
- 成功案例:研究其他开发者如何成功地在Chrome浏览器上实现网页兼容性优化的案例,学习他们的经验和技巧。
- 失败案例:分析那些未能在Chrome浏览器上正常工作的网页案例,了解其中的原因,避免重蹈覆辙。
七、持续学习和改进
- 跟进技术动态:随着技术的不断发展,持续学习新的知识和技能,以便能够快速适应变化。
- 定期回顾和评估:定期回顾您的网页兼容性策略,评估其有效性,并根据需要进行调整。
通过上述步骤,您可以有效地进行Chrome浏览器的网页兼容性优化。记住,这是一个持续的过程,需要不断地测试、学习和改进。